Transaction ffdd851142c77d7d1686a816a2913668d79ef9e150475542d90811b54ea233bd

3 Input
2 Outputs
  • ffdd851142c77d7d1686a816a2913668d79ef9e150475542d90811b54ea233bd:0
  • value  1083129
    address  bc1qdcu4xazgnl0r0fpnyw4dqd9z47eakj68ddlmyk
  • ffdd851142c77d7d1686a816a2913668d79ef9e150475542d90811b54ea233bd:1
  • value  480081
    address  3F9a5zqvxd99CeRdQx3YjR3aY2m9rHrXzZ